How they compare
Saudi Arabia currently reports 3.5% against 3.4% in Albania,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 13 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Saudi Arabia ahead.
Albania ranks 77th and Saudi Arabia ranks 76th of 174 countries.
Albania has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
Marine protected areas are regions of intertidal or sub-tidal land and associated water, flora and fauna, and cultural and historical features that have been legally or effectively reserved for protection.
